whoaaaaaaa... just had an epiphany....



anybody notice how uma thurman is wearing that yellow jumpsuit in the showdown with O-ren's army, and the whole army is wearing Kato masks (they're even pointed out specifically as "Kato masks")??

yellow jumpsuit = Bruce Lee's outfit in Game of Death...
Kato = Bruce Lee's character from the Green Hornet tv show...
David Carradine = the man who stole Bruce Lee's role in the tv series "Kung Fu"

therefore...

Uma's mission to Kill Bill = Bruce Lee's revenge on David Carradine!!

IT'S CRAZY!!

Actually this was never meant to be a 2 volume movie...but it was going to be like a 4 hour movie so Mirimax (i think that was the company) decided to cut it into two movies.
The critics yelled because they were saying it's about the money, and that's why mirimax is doing into two...but Miramax said, no, it's stritly about the time....then the critics said if it's just about the time, then give everyone who buys the tickets to the first one a ticket for the second one. crickets chirping.
